Took a quick peek at the menu online. If it’s accurate, you won’t want to skip the chicken livers. Also, if you haven’t had their cornbread, you need to do that.
Other than that, go crazy with wherever, but be sure to balance the meal with some lighter/brighter dishes. A dinner at HH can get a wee bit too heavy for its own good if you aren’t paying attention.

I went about two months ago for dinner and had a great time. I second @frommtron – get the chicken livers and the cornbread. The chop steak with fried oysters was an interesting combination but also a standout. Octopus is solid and I would definitely order it again, but the preparation is nothing you havent seen/had before. I saw another table with the smoked trout and rye griddle cakes, which looked fantastic.

Having skipped breakfast and lunch and only snacked on burrata/crostini and 1/2 d of oysters at Esters we were starving! So Hatchet Hall is perfect as we love it and we kept a huge appetite. They tried to put us in the parking lot but due to this being a very special rare occasion she complained and got seated in their nicer garden area, unfortunately we had to take up a big table but we ordered like one


the peel and eat shrimp were wonderful… i really need to learn to prepare them this way… can’t be hard.


perfect ceviche as well… nicely undercured, seasoned just right… fleshy and satisfying with the tostada crunch


Salad was a sleeper order… i looked at her sideways when she asked for it but we destroyed it… so very airy with its curls and perfectly dressed… never enough anchovies for us.


these dragon i think beans were great with the pork


there aren’t enough words of praise for this cornbread… wow. side and dessert all at once.


heritage pork with fennel pollen… could have used a bit more i suppose but great pork, well roasted. umbrian bottle played a great partner


and the whole branzino was right on as well… we left nothing

Great return to a west side favorite… will miss the chefs we’ve loved but hasn’t missed a beat at least for us.
